ISA 450 · Logistics

Misstatement Tracker
for Logistics

Accumulate misstatements across freight revenue recognition, fleet depreciation and impairment, fuel hedging, and intercompany charges for multi-jurisdictional logistics operations.

ISA 450v2026.04EUR

Every misstatement, evaluated.
Not just accumulated.

Session
0xBB27
Period
FY 2026
Standard
ISA 450
misstatements.conf
evaluation.conf
README.md
01// engagement— ISA 450.3
02entity_name=
03reporting_period=
04currency=
05// materiality_thresholds— ISA 320 / ISA 450.5
06performance_materiality=
07clearly_trivial=
08overall_materiality=€ (optional)
09ctt.rationale=
10accumulation_policy=
CTT rationale + accumulation policy (ISA 450.5)
12// misstatement_items— ISA 450.5 accumulation + classification
13item[0].desc=
25// evaluation_method— ISA 450.A16 · iron curtain vs rollover · use higher
26method=
27iron_curtain_total=
28rollover_total=
29prior_period_carryforward=
Evaluation method · iron curtain vs rollover + prior period
32// qualitative_factors— ISA 450.A20–A21 · material regardless of amount
Per-item qualitative flags — tick those relevant for each item below:
40qualitative_narrative=
Qualitative factors · per-item + narrative (ISA 450.A20–A21)
45// contextual_intelligence— ISA 450.A14 pattern detection
Enter items and thresholds to run pattern detection.
Contextual intelligence · pattern detection
48// pm_sensitivity— ISA 320.12 / ISA 450.6
Enter PM and misstatements to run sensitivity.
PM sensitivity · ±25% impact
52// correction_priority— which items to correct first
Enter items and thresholds to generate correction priority.
Correction priority · sequencing
56// communication_record— ISA 450.8–9 · management · ISA 450.12–13 · TCWG
57mgmt.date
58mgmt.notes=
59tcwg.date
60tcwg.notes=
Communication · management + TCWG
65// written_representations— ISA 450.14 / ISA 580.A10
66obtained=
67date=
68notes=
Written representations · ISA 450.14 / ISA 580
70// opinion_conclusion— ISA 450.11 / ISA 705
71decision=
72rationale=
Opinion conclusion · unmodified / qualified / adverse / disclaimer
awaiting input·1 item(s) · 0 fields · 0 warning(s)·ISA 450 compliantEUR
Total uncorrected
Awaiting input
PRIMARY
Items above CTT
ISA 450.5
Net profit effect
Qualitative flags
Risk indicators
EXPORT (EMAIL TO UNLOCK)

Email unlocks the free download.

No payment required. Unlock above to download the full working paper.

Format
HTML → PDF
Standard
ISA 450
Price
FREE
or CtrlE

ISA 450 misstatement evaluation for Logistics

Logistics companies process high volumes of transactions with individually low values, which means sampling drives the audit approach and projected misstatements dominate the ISA 450 schedule. A mid-market freight forwarder might process 50,000 shipments per year, each with a revenue recognition point that depends on the applicable Incoterms, the number of performance obligations in the contract, and whether the company acts as principal or agent. ISA 530.14 requires the auditor to project misstatements found in the sample across the untested population, and in logistics, even a small error rate produces a large projected misstatement given the transaction volume. The tracker handles stratified projections so you can separate domestic from international shipments, full-truckload from less-than-truckload, and warehousing from transport.

The principal-versus-agent assessment under IFRS 15.B34 is the single most common source of revenue misstatement in logistics. When a freight forwarder books space on a shipping line and resells it to a customer, the question is whether the forwarder controls the service before it is transferred to the customer. If the forwarder acts as principal, revenue is the gross amount billed to the customer. If the forwarder acts as agent, revenue is only the commission or margin. The difference between gross and net presentation can be an order of magnitude. A forwarder recognising €80M of gross revenue might only have €12M of net revenue if the agent assessment applies. Management's assessment of the principal-agent question for each service line determines the revenue figure, and the auditor needs to evaluate whether that assessment is correct under IFRS 15.B35-B37. If the auditor disagrees on even one service line, the misstatement is the gross-to-net difference for all transactions in that line.

Fleet assets (trucks, trailers, containers, aircraft) create misstatement risks around useful life estimates, residual values, and impairment triggers. IAS 16.51 requires entities to review useful lives and residual values at least annually. Logistics companies operating in competitive markets with rapid fleet turnover often have outdated residual value assumptions that overstate the carrying value of older vehicles. When the auditor compares the residual value assumptions to recent disposal proceeds and finds a consistent shortfall, the aggregate depreciation understatement across the fleet is a judgmental misstatement. For a company with €25M of fleet assets and residual values overstated by 8%, the misstatement is €2M in the balance sheet and a corresponding understatement of depreciation expense. IFRS 16 right-of-use assets for leased fleet also require impairment assessment under IAS 36 if indicators exist.

Multi-leg shipments create revenue and cost accrual misstatements at period end. A shipment that starts on 28 December and arrives on 5 January involves costs and revenue that span two reporting periods. Under IFRS 15, revenue is recognised when the performance obligation is satisfied, which for a freight service is typically when the goods are delivered. If the performance obligation is satisfied over time (because the customer simultaneously receives and consumes the benefit), revenue should be recognised over the transit period based on progress. Costs incurred but not yet invoiced by subcontractors at period end need to be accrued. Logistics companies with thousands of shipments in transit at year-end often rely on automated accrual systems that use estimated transit times and cost rates. Differences between these estimates and actual outcomes produce misstatements. Test the accrual by comparing estimates to actual invoices received in the subsequent period and record the difference.

Frequently asked questions: Logistics

How should I project misstatements from shipment testing across the full logistics population?
Stratify by service type (road freight, sea freight, air freight, warehousing) and by transaction size. Error rates typically differ across service types because the revenue recognition model and the principal-versus-agent assessment may vary. ISA 530.14 requires projection within each stratum. The tracker lets you define strata and calculates the projected misstatement for each one separately.
Is a principal-versus-agent misclassification a factual or judgmental misstatement?
It depends. If the facts clearly support one classification and management chose the other, it is a factual misstatement. If the assessment involves genuine judgment (for example, the forwarder has some but not full control over the service), it is a judgmental misstatement. In either case, the misstatement amount is the difference between gross and net revenue for the affected transactions, which can be very large.
How do I handle fleet residual value misstatements across hundreds of assets?
Calculate the aggregate misstatement across the fleet rather than tracking each vehicle individually. Determine the average overstatement per asset class (rigid trucks, articulated trucks, trailers) by comparing residual value assumptions to recent disposal data. Multiply by the number of assets in each class. Record this as a judgmental misstatement because it arises from a difference in estimates.
What cut-off testing approach works for multi-leg shipments?
Select a sample of shipments in transit at year-end and trace the estimated revenue accrual to the actual billing. Also select a sample of subcontractor cost accruals and trace to the actual invoices received post-year-end. The difference between estimated and actual amounts, extrapolated across the full population of in-transit shipments, is the projected misstatement.

Related industry guides

General Tracker

Get practical audit insights, weekly.

No exam theory. Just what makes audits run faster.

290+ guides published20 free toolsBuilt by practicing auditors

No spam. We’re auditors, not marketers.